Welcome to the ILequity.com - the civil rights reference and self-assessment tool for secondary schools in Illinois. This website is funded by the Illinois State Board of Education (ISBE) and is designed to provide information, direct links to legislation, and helpful resources related to civil rights.   The tools provided on this site are designed to assist your LEA in assessing its compliance with federal civil rights legislation and provide technical assistance to those LEAs preparing for an onsite civil rights review.
